North Oldham and Collins are an even 4-4 against one another since February of 2016, but not for long. The North Oldham Mustangs will welcome the Collins Titans at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. The timing is sure in North Oldham's favor as the team sits on seven straight wins at home while Collins has been banged up by three consecutive losses on the road.
Last Wednesday, North Oldham was able to grind out a solid win over Owen County, taking the game 56-43. The victory continues a trend for the Mustangs in their matchups with the Rebels: they've now won four in a row.
Meanwhile, Collins came up short against Madison Central on Saturday and fell 61-53.
North Oldham's win bumped their record up to 16-7. As for Collins, their defeat dropped their record down to 9-14.
North Oldham strolled past Collins in their previous matchup back in February of 2024 by a score of 60-43. Does North Oldham have another victory up their sleeve, or will Collins tur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
